  • Judge rules Pandora must pay 1.8 percent of annual revenue to ASCAP, and ASCAP isn't happy.

    A rate court judge has issued a ruling in the argument between Pandora and the American Society of Composers, Authors and Publishers (ASCAP). Judge Denise Cote ruled that Pandora would pay ASCAP, a non-profit which handles copyrights and issues royalties for its members, 1.85 percent of its annual revenue. For those unfamiliar with the going rates for music streaming services: Pandora's the winner here, and ASCAP isn't happy.

  • Kayne West sentenced to two years probation in paparazzo battery case

    Following a fight between him and paparazzo Daniel Ramos in 2013, Kanye West has been sentenced to two years of probation, TMZ reports.West was not prosecuted, having struck a deal with the plaintiff and pleading no contest to misdemeanor battery charge. His additional attempted grand theft charge has been dismissed.

  • Lawsuit between Beaties Boys and feminist toy company GoldieBlox ends in settlement

    After an almost four-month back-and-forth legal battle, Beastie Boys and feminist toy company GoldieBlox have settled a lawsuit about the fair use of the hip-hop trio's 1987 track "Girls" for a parody ad campaign. According to The Hollywood Reporter, with the settlement agreement, the terms of which haven't been made known, the case is dismissed with prejudice.
  • Chris Brown will stay in jail for month after multiple rehab infractions

    After getting the boot from rehab, it seems as though singer Chris Brown will be sticking around in jail. Yesterday (March 17), a judge ordered that Brown would not be able to enter another rehab facility until his April 23 court hearing regarding his probation in the 2009 Rihanna assault case.
